Food Handler's Certification Requirement: 
As a requirement by the Illinois Department of Health (Section 750.570 of the Illinois Food Service Sanitation Code) all food handling employees are required obtain a food handling certification within 30 days of hire. Certifications must be accredited by the American National Standards Institute and can be completed online within a 24 hour period.
